In news that no doubt has social media website Instagram quaking in fear, notorious rapper Kanye West has returned to the platform after several months. Usually, actions of this calibre usually coincide with one of the rapper’s many album rollouts or public beefs, but it seems he’s opting for a more pressing matter this time: McDonalds packaging.

The return post sees the ‘All Falls Down’ rapper post a teaser of his upcoming collab with Japanese industrial designer Naoto Fukasawa. If you’re not familiar with Fukasawa’s resumè, he’s garnered critical acclaim in the design world and is frequently referred to as one of the most influential designers in the world.

Thus, you’d expect his McDonalds cheeseburger collab with Yeezy to blow your socks off, but regrettably, the pair have managed to make the beloved favourite look distinctly unappetising, turning it into a square and encasing it in translucent wrapping paper. To add insult to injury, the colour palette of the paper swaps out the usually vibrant and eye-catching colours of the OG packaging for a muted and desaturated alternative.
